Mathilde Hylleberg (born 1 December 1998) is a former Danish female handball player, who last played for TTH Holstebro and the Danish national team. [1] [2]
She participated at the 2018 European Women's Handball Championship. [3]
She ended her playing career at only 21, citing a lack of motivation as the reason. [4] She un-retired in 2022, where she signed a one-year contract with TTH Holstebro. [5] When the women's team broke away from TTH and became Holstebro Håndbold, she followed the club. In 2023 she extended her contract until 2026. [6]
